Output eb3c852d169c0f427921f2516ae2b595b881cf8f201402135ea98e883e165011:4

value
321304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5947e5138da4e16deefd0ea2ecc9c05c482279d OP_EQUAL
address
3NcvYydCiEVSTzs5BnBshozsGjotcMuNQE
transaction
eb3c852d169c0f427921f2516ae2b595b881cf8f201402135ea98e883e165011
confirmations
347392
spent
true